Vortexa is a fast-growing international technology business founded to solve the immense information gap that exists in the energy industry. By using massive amounts of new satellite data and pioneering work in artificial intelligence, Vortexa creates an unprecedented view on the global seaborne energy flows in real-time, bringing transparency and efficiency to the energy markets and society as a whole.

Vortexa’s Data Platform, designed, developed and maintained by the Data Production Team, is a cloud-native ecosystem that powers the full lifecycle of our data and intelligence products. It integrates large-scale data pipelines, machine-learning models, AI agents, human-in-the-loop systems, and microservices to collect, process, connect, and govern global energy-flow data at scale. This platform underpins analytics, operational workflows, and real-time decision-making across the company. Our models ingest and interpret a diverse range of data, from satellite imagery and sensor feeds for millions of energy assets to unstructured commercial and operational shipping data such as customs filings, fixtures, and SPAs. These inputs drive predictive systems that support energy-demand forecasting, anomaly detection, and real-time recommendations for physical and derivative trading.

As a Principal Data Scientist, you will become a key part of the Data Platform Team to play a central role in designing, implementing, and deploying advanced AI/ML methodologies and production-grade systems. Your work will be held to the scrutiny of energy analysts, traders, operations teams, and regulatory stakeholders, and must meet the performance, reliability, and robustness standards required for critical energy infrastructure. You will collaborate closely with software engineers, data scientists, and domain experts to translate cutting-edge research into operational, trading-ready intelligence.
